So, when she realised she was falling for Strictly Come Dancing pro Gorka Márquez – who couldn't be much less like the character made well-known by Sylvester Stallone – no one was more stunned than Gemma.

"If someone had stated: 'OK, he's Spanish, a dancer and wears sparkles on a weekend,' I might have gone: 'Oh no, clearly he's not for me,'" she laughs.

Six years, an engagement and two youngsters later, it's protected to say that Gemma's changed her thoughts.

Meeting Gorka, 33, was a penny-drop moment. The more she acquired to know him, the more she realised why she'd been left so heartbroken up to now.

"That's the place I'd been going incorrect – I was all the time going for the dangerous boys. As soon as you give a nice lad a chance, you realise you don't should be always questioning where you stand. Gorka opened my eyes to what a relationship must be like."

She provides: "I mean, I'm nonetheless obsessive about John Rambo and Rocky Balboa. Rambo nonetheless seems to be good to me! However I'm past that stage of life where I just like the dangerous boy."

Nevertheless, stories lately steered they've been feeling the pressure of the frequent spells of separation created by Gorka's work, with sources saying Gemma, 39, was effectively caring for Mia, 4, and six-month-old Thiago on her own.

As well as Gorka's Strictly commitments, which commonly take him away from the family house in Larger Manchester, there are the nationwide excursions with Karen Hauer for their Firedance present.

Plus, he's at present having fun with a new position as a decide on the Spanish model of Strictly, referred to as Bailando Con Las Estrellas.

It means he's away filming in Spain every weekend – cue rumours of a "rough patch" brought on by time apart.

Nevertheless, Gemma says it's something they've each grown used to and – whisper it – there are points to being away from one another that she somewhat enjoys.

"If I'm with someone 24/7, I get really bored of them they usually do my head in.

"Even wanting behind their head can annoy me! I really like my very own area, and every time he's on Strictly, I see it as my time alone with Mia and Thiago. Mia sleeps in my bed and it's so nice.

"Some ladies message me and say: 'How do you cope? He's by no means there!' I imply, come on. There are military wives who don't see their partners for months, so a few weeks right here and there's nothing.

"He flies out on the Friday and his flight house on Sunday lands at 10am. So, compared to Strictly, it's truly very straightforward.

"And it's bizarre how one can really feel so related, although you're physically aside. It's six years now, however I still miss him when he's away and we still have issues to speak about once we're collectively."&

In fact, a lot of Gorka's time away is spent in the arms of varied feminine dance partners.

He's been partnered on Strictly with Maisie Smith, Helen Skelton and, most just lately, Nikita Kanda – they have been the second couple to be eliminated in 2023. But the so-called Strictly Curse isn't something that retains Gemma awake at night time.&

"It doesn't hassle me in any respect, perhaps because I'm within the business myself. On my first day on Emmerdale, I met Michael Parr [who played Ross Barton] within the morning and had to kiss him that afternoon. We thought nothing of it.

"I stated: 'Nice to satisfy you,' had lunch, kissed him, went residence. "Don't get me incorrect, Gorka loves Strictly, nevertheless it's his job."

Eagle-eyed viewers shouldn't read something into the truth that she's not often in the studio audience, either.

Gemma prefers to help Gorka from the comfort of her sofa, alongside Mia, and can also be aware that her presence might be off-putting to his movie star associate.

"Gorka's all the time telling me to return and watch – he says it seems like I don't care, because I'm by no means in the viewers!

"But I'm cautious because I've been a contestant and I do know that the very last thing his associate needs is me on the front row every Saturday respiration down their neck. I don't assume that may be truthful, because that's their time with him and they should take pleasure in it.

"So I just hold out of it and let him do his factor, so they can enjoy the journey with him."

Gemma herself virtually didn't take up Strictly's supply of a place in 2017. After 16 years within the highlight, starring in Hollyoaks, Casualty and Emmerdale, and having been the darling of the lads' mags, she'd settled into a new radio-presenting position.

The considered placing herself "out there" once more crammed her with dread.

"Strictly is the most important present on telly and I didn't need to do it. Once I was in Hollyoaks, there was no social media. I'm positive I was judged by individuals having their breakfast and seeing me in the paper, saying issues like: 'Oh, it's her in her underwear again!'

"However they couldn't physically put that on me. So I undoubtedly had the worry about getting out there again."

After happening holiday, she ultimately determined to simply accept, and it couldn't have labored out any higher.&

Gemma danced all the best way to the ultimate together with her professional companion Aljaž Škorjanec ("He took me to another degree confidence-wise. He used to go: 'F**okay it, we're simply dancing!' And he was right.").

She additionally made her relationship official with Gorka shortly after the present, and the remaining is history.

However Strictly or no Strictly, she believes fate would have brought them collectively anyway.

"I feel I nonetheless would have met him. We didn't realize it once we obtained together, nevertheless it turned out we now have mutual associates within the health business and have worked with the identical brands, so I feel we all the time would have crossed paths. I do know I might have met him someway.

"I do consider in coincidence, however I additionally assume what's meant for you gained't move you by. It's the entire 'sliding-doors' impact.

"Had I accomplished Strictly the previous yr, it might have been& utterly totally different, as I used to be in a relationship at the moment. I did Strictly once we have been both single, and there's no one else I can ever imagine having a household with."

Their family, she says, is now full. They are elevating Mia and Thiago to be bilingual and are within the process of shopping for a vacation residence in Spain, but there are not any plans for any extra youngsters.

"I feel like a great deal of individuals set me up for the worst, saying it was going to be really robust with two and asking how was I going to cope. Even I was considering: 'Oh my god, what have I completed?'

"But I've found it's like muscle reminiscence together with your second youngster. You've a listing in your head of what to do, so in that respect it's been quite a bit simpler, because I've not panicked. He's just slotted in, really!"

It does imply that, even once they're collectively, Gemma and Gorka's time as a pair may be restricted.

Once they first obtained together, she stated their relationship could possibly be defined as "greatest buddies who can't hold their arms off each other". But new baby equals tired mother and father, and it's not the description she'd give now!

"Not a lot! With babies, it's not that the intimacy goes, however because we're each knackered, it switches.

"Intimacy to me may be if I'm in the kitchen and he walks previous and provides me a bit of peck on the cheek or a again rub.

"Each morning, he provides me the most important kiss and doesn't care that I haven't brushed my tooth! You grow to be more related when you have got youngsters& – mentally and emotionally. Physically, it's nonetheless there, nevertheless it takes on a special which means.

"Gorka all the time says he has such a degree of respect for me, seeing me undergo two C-sections to convey his youngsters into the world. And once in a while, I remind him of that, too!"

Gemma has recovered properly from Thiago's start and didn't push herself to return to the load training that previously stored her match. After resting her physique for a number of months, she's now halfway by means of a 12-week programme with PT Steve Chambers, AKA "Evil Steve", however with the goal to bulk up slightly than shed extra pounds.

"For 3 months after having Thiago, I still seemed pregnant. It's only in the final two months that I've began to get again to my regular measurement.

"With each of them, I feel everybody assumed because I was so match, I'd just go back to coaching, however it wasn't the case.

"I used to be nonetheless therapeutic, but what I might do was not eat a Mars bar day by day! When you make little modifications and give attention to what you can do moderately than what you'll be able to't, then it snowballs and it's exhausting to really feel dangerous a few body you're taking good care of.

"The truth that I've carried and given start to 2 youngsters blows my mind. That's the feminine body doing its factor and it's a privilege denied to so many ladies.

"To moan about gaining weight is so insignificant when there are ladies who would kill to have stretch marks from a pregnancy."

She's still formally on maternity depart, but Gemma is as a lot in demand for work as Gorka.

Since Strictly, her profile has soared – she has written a collection of health and fitness books, launched collections with style web site In The Type, moved to present the drive-time slot on Hits Radio (she returns to the airwaves in April) and, final yr, branched out into podcasting together with her show The Overshare.

She's additionally simply released her debut youngsters's e-book, Canine Don't Dance, written whereas pregnant with Thiago, a few dachshund referred to as Dave who needs to bop, but is informed by everyone he meets to overlook about it.

"I assumed it will give me one thing to give attention to in the direction of the top of pregnancy," she says.

"I knew I needed to include canine and then with the dance aspect, it took me back to Strictly, when every week I'd thought I'd overlook the routine.

"Although I was nervous, I received via it, so I assumed that may be an excellent message about making an attempt new issues."

The story itself will undoubtedly have large attraction, however there are some parts which are deeply private to Gemma.

Dave is known as after her dad David, who died of a coronary heart assault when she was just 17. And the characters of canine Dave and Dusty are based mostly on her personal pooches, Ollie ("wild and can attempt something") and Norman ("far more delicate and timid").

Gemma might have quite a bit happening, however it seems like she's discovered some stability between work and home life. "I've been in this business since I used to be 15 and I'll be 40 this yr, so it's been most of my life," she says.&

"The radio I do is 30 minutes from my house and I get to do the varsity run within the mornings. It's nice to be in that place where it's all quite manageable. And I really feel very lucky for that, I really do."&
